Disaster Haven Network: Global & Local

The escalating frequency and impact of global emergencies have spurred the development of sophisticated Emergency Refuge Networks, operating on both a worldwide and local basis. Globally, organizations like the UNHCR work to coordinate responses and provide immediate housing for displaced populations, while simultaneously grassroots movements and local communities are building robust systems for support closer to home. These networks leverage digital tools, from mobile applications for resource allocation to online platforms for volunteer recruitment. Critically, the effectiveness of any Emergency Refuge Network hinges on the collaboration of governments, charities, and local residents, ensuring a quick and empathetic response when people are most vulnerable. Ultimately, a layered approach—combining international knowledge with localized awareness—is the key to providing safe and protected refuge during times of unforeseen hardship.

Vital Shelters Internationally & Regional Support

Access to reliable shelter is a basic human right, yet countless individuals and families across the globe face displacement and homelessness. International organizations, such as the UNHCR and Red Cross, provide significant support including emergency accommodation, nourishment, and healthcare services to those affected by conflict, natural disasters, and poverty. Simultaneously, community shelters and volunteer-run groups play an vital role in addressing homelessness within their own areas. These grassroots initiatives often offer temporary accommodation, case management, job training, and connections to stable housing options. Supporting these varied resources, both international and community, is essential to reducing human distress and promoting dignity for all. Support to these organizations, either monetary or through volunteering, can have a deep impact.
